Deploy step 4: FuelLedger report service. Confirm the container runs as a non-root user and egress is limited to the telemetry bucket. Config lives in /opt/fuelledger/.env; all non-sensitive keys are templated by the pipeline. Review the rendered file before promotion. One value is injected by hand during cutover: the reporting API credential goes on the line immediately after this step.

vault entry, yahif-yajep: COURIER_KEY29=b802bdf8034096b65a51c6ba5abe2

Recovery procedure — Glassbill snapshot account. Reviewer note: if the snapshot-baseline bot account is locked, verify the last approved baseline hash before proceeding. Then invoke the recovery flow from the Glassbill admin console, confirming the audit entry is written. The flow requires the bot's recovery passphrase, reproduced below for verification against the sealed record:

strongbox words: novwyn-julvan-weniel-jorax-sorix-pelath-druwyn-druok-soreth

Reviewers: every release is built in the sealed pipeline, signed, and its provenance attestation is attached to the image. Verify the attestation before approving a promotion — unsigned images must not reach the sweeper's service account, since it holds delete permissions. The manifest lists source commit, builder identity, and dependency digests. Discrepancies block the release automatically. The attested build token for the current release appears below.

trace token, kahog-tajeg: htk6_97d963